Understanding Commercial Roofing Systems
Commercial roofs are far more complex than residential roofs. Depending on your building, your roofing system may include:
  • TPO membranes
  • EPDM rubber roofing
  • PVC roofing
  • Modified bitumen
  • Built-up roofing (BUR)
  • Metal roofing systems
  • Roof coatings
  • Multiple insulation layers
  • Vapor barriers
  • Drainage systems

Each system requires specific repair methods, materials, and installation procedures. Using the wrong adhesive, fastener, or patching technique can actually void manufacturer warranties and shorten the roof's lifespan.

Why DIY Repairs Can Be Risky
Many building owners are tempted to fix a leak with roofing cement or sealant after spotting water inside. While this may appear to solve the problem temporarily, it often masks a larger issue.

Hidden Damage
Water rarely enters a building directly above the leak.  Moisture can travel beneath roofing membranes, insulation boards, or structural decking before becoming visible inside. Without specialized equipment, it's extremely difficult to locate the true source of the problem.  Professional roofers use moisture detection tools, infrared scanning, and detailed inspections to identify the entire affected area—not just the visible leak.

Safety Hazards
Commercial roofs present significant safety concerns.
Potential hazards include:
  • Slippery roofing membranes
  • Roof edges
  • Skylights
  • Wet surfaces
  • Electrical equipment
  • HVAC units
  • High winds
  • Uneven surfaces
Falls remain one of the leading causes of construction injuries. Professional roofing crews receive extensive safety training and use proper fall protection equipment designed specifically for commercial roofing environments.

The Cost of Mistakes
One improperly completed repair can create much larger problems later.
Common DIY mistakes include:
  • Using incompatible roofing materials
  • Improper seam repairs
  • Blocking drainage paths
  • Damaging roofing membranes
  • Overlooking wet insulation
  • Creating additional punctures
  • Trapping moisture beneath repairs
What begins as a few hundred dollars in attempted savings can easily become thousands of dollars in future repairs or even a complete roof replacement.

When DIY Maintenance Makes Sense
While actual repairs should usually be left to professionals, property managers can safely perform basic roof maintenance.
Examples include:
  • Removing leaves from drains
  • Clearing branches after storms
  • Reporting visible damage
  • Checking interior ceilings for stains
  • Monitoring rooftop equipment access
  • Scheduling inspections promptly

Routine observation helps catch small problems before they become expensive emergencies.

However, building owners should avoid walking unnecessarily on roofing membranes, especially after storms or during icy conditions.

Common Commercial Roof Problems
Professional inspections often uncover issues such as:
Membrane PuncturesDropped tools, foot traffic, and rooftop equipment can puncture roofing membranes.
Flashing FailuresRoof penetrations are among the most common leak locations.
Ponding WaterStanding water accelerates membrane deterioration and increases structural loads.

Storm Damage
Detroit experiences heavy snow, hail, high winds, and freeze-thaw cycles that place significant stress on commercial roofs.

Aging Materials
Even well-maintained roofs eventually require repairs due to normal weathering and UV exposure.

Preventative Maintenance Is the Best Investment
The best repair is often the one you never need.
Routine maintenance programs help identify:
  • Loose flashing
  • Small punctures
  • Blocked drains
  • Worn sealants
  • Membrane shrinkage
  • Early moisture intrusion

Addressing these issues early dramatically reduces repair costs and extends the life of your roof.

Motor City Roofers recommends scheduling commercial roof inspections at least twice each year—once in the spring after winter weather and again in the fall before snow and freezing temperatures arrive.
